The Ultimate Guide to Neo Geo CD Emulation on Android The Neo Geo CD remains one of the most fascinating consoles of the 1990s. It offered arcade-perfect ports of legendary SNK titles like Metal Slug , King of Fighters , and Samurai Shodown , but with a massive upgrade: high-fidelity, redbook CD audio. Today, modern Android devices are powerful enough to emulate this classic hardware perfectly.

If RetroArch feels too intimidating, Lemuroid is a fantastic, open-source alternative. It uses the same Libretro cores but hides the complex menus behind a clean, automated interface.

If you experience crackling audio, your buffer size may be too low. Navigate to the emulator's audio settings and slightly increase the audio latency buffer until the music flows smoothly. Touch vs. Physical Controllers
